 * My goal is to have my permalinks behave like this:
 * [http://www.colindunn.com/postname](http://www.colindunn.com/postname) (for specific
   posts)
    [http://www.colindunn.com/category](http://www.colindunn.com/category)(
   browse by category) [http://www.colindunn.com/page](http://www.colindunn.com/page)(
   browse by page)
 * BUT, when I change one it always breaks the other. Configuring my permalinks 
   likes this:
 * [http://www.colindunn.com/%postname%](http://www.colindunn.com/%postname%)
 * Disallows browsing categories this way
 * [http://www.colindunn.com/category](http://www.colindunn.com/category)
 * I get a 404 error. And if I change the category base to %category% while the 
   permalink is set to %postname% the individual posts break.
 * Anyone have a solution to this problem?

 * Try setting your post permalinks to `/%post_id%/%postname%/` and leave the category
   base blank. It still won’t be your ideal structure but I think it’s the closest
   you’ll get without potentially impacting on performance.

 * Aha! Found a plugin for anyone who is interested. “WP No Category Base” does 
   the trick!
